Output 63ec40cf116a254ed3a6f1c96e84e0a121d2d5480da7d0c63178befef9c98da9:74

value
230851
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d5f80fc9c78d3e0c5c3e8d0301c6230b780debee OP_EQUAL
address
3MCP22juA4znYKSk5zcC7ZJtmkjE6huBMJ
transaction
63ec40cf116a254ed3a6f1c96e84e0a121d2d5480da7d0c63178befef9c98da9
confirmations
101483
spent
true